En el primer while creo el siguiente array:
Código PHP :
$p_array[] = array("valor1" => "$valor1", "valor2" => "$valor2");Y en el segundo while creo:
Código PHP :
$s_array[] = array("valor3" => "$valor3");Y ahora necesito crear un nuevo array que junto los dos anteriores para mostrarlo así:
Código PHP :
foreach ($resumen as $key => $value) { echo $value['valor1']; echo $value['valor2']; echo $value['valor3']; }¿Cómo sería la formulación correcta para unir $p_array y $s_array? He probado lo siguiente después de horas y horas de lectura con los siguientes resultados:
Código PHP :
//lo siguiente sólo muestra los resultados de $p_array pero no de $s_array $resumen = $p_array + $s_array; //lo siguiente muestra los resultados de $p_array y dice que $valor3 no está definido e inmediatamente después muestra los datos de $valor3 y dice que $valor1 y $valor2 no están definidos. //primer while: $resumen[] = array("valor1" => "$valor1", "valor2" => "$valor2"); //segundo while $resumen[] = array("valor3" => "$valor3");Todas las demás formas que he probado me arrojan error.
Por favor, ayuda. Seré tonto pero aún no logro entender dónde radica el problema.
De antemano muchas gracias.